Arrival of G550 prompts launch of Boutsen design

Boutsen Aviation has taken delivery of a new Gulfstream G550 for one of its clients.

Thierry Boutsen, ceo, said: "This G550 was ordered a year ago for one of our clients as part of an acquisition contract. We negotiated the sales agreement, advised our customer in the choice of interior layout and decoration, followed the construction of the aircraft as well as its cabin completion. I have to congratulate the Gulfstream team in Appleton for the fantastic work, we collected an aircraft with absolutely no squawks!"

Daniela Boutsen, vp marketing and interior design, added: "The arrival of the Gulfstream G550 was the perfect moment to officially launch our aircraft interior design department. We had already outfitted the two Airbus ACJs with the best and finest equipment available for glassware, cutlery, plates, bed linen, plaids plus all the decorative items which make our aircraft the nicest ones in the business. This G550 is the one that triggered the creation of our new department and we look forward to outfitting many more customer aircraft from now on."

The Gulfstream G550 has joined the two Airbus ACJs that Boutsen Aviation has under its financial and operational control. All three aircraft are now based in Stuttgart, where they are operated by DC Aviation and are available for charter.

Michael Kuhn, ceo of DC Aviation, added: "We are very pleased to add this G550 to our fleet of managed aircraft. The demand for charter in this segment is high."
